Bayern handed boost as Jamal Musiala targets August return after surgery

The 23-year-old had a metal plate removed from his foot, which had been inserted after the serious injury he suffered last year. The operation is expected to help resolve the lingering problems that affected him throughout the previous campaign.

According to Kicker, Musiala chose to have the procedure done during the off-season rather than wait until the winter break, allowing him more time to recover before the new campaign begins.

The Germany international is expected to return to Bayern's training base at Sabener Strasse on July 31 after being given a few extra days of holiday. If his rehabilitation goes according to plan, he hopes to rejoin full team training on August 8.

That timeline would put Musiala in contention for Bayern's first competitive fixture of the season, the German Supercup against Borussia Dortmund at Signal Iduna Park on August 22.

Bayern will then begin the defence of their Bundesliga title away to VfB Stuttgart on August 28.

Musiala's recovery will be closely monitored, but the latest procedure is expected to give the attacking midfielder the best chance of returning fully fit and without the long-term foot issues that disrupted his performances last season.
